Abstract:
A radio transmitting station includes: multiple transmitting antenna elements configured to transform electrical signals into radio waves and emit the radio waves; a precoder configured to control a beam direction of the radio waves to be emitted from the multiple transmitting antenna elements by giving precoding weights to the electrical signals to be supplied to the multiple transmitting antenna elements; and at least one power adjuster configured to adjust power of an electrical signal that is to be supplied to at least a portion of the multiple transmitting antenna elements, such that differences between powers of the electrical signals to be supplied to the multiple transmitting antenna elements are reduced.
